The global market for low-speed motors and generators in the oil and gas sector is on a steady growth trajectory, projected to expand from $3,181.26 million in 2021 to $5,709.81 million by 2033, demonstrating a compound annual growth rate (CAGR) of 4.995%. This growth is primarily fueled by the persistent global demand for energy, necessitating continuous exploration, production, and processing activities. The market is characterized by a strong emphasis on operational efficiency, reliability, and safety, driving the adoption of advanced motor and generator technologies. Key applications include driving pumps, compressors, and drilling equipment where high torque at low speeds is crucial. The Asia Pacific region stands out as the largest and fastest-growing market, propelled by rapid industrialization and increasing energy needs in countries like China and India. Technological advancements, such as the integration of IoT for predictive maintenance and the development of more robust, energy-efficient permanent magnet motors, are shaping the competitive landscape. However, the market faces challenges from the volatility of oil prices and the increasing global momentum towards renewable energy sources.
The market is experiencing a significant technological shift towards more energy-efficient solutions, such as permanent magnet (PM) synchronous motors and direct-drive systems, which offer higher torque density, improved reliability, and lower maintenance costs, aligning with industry-wide sustainability and cost-reduction goals.
Asia Pacific is solidifying its position as the dominant market, driven by substantial investments in oil and gas infrastructure, particularly in China, India, and Southeast Asian nations. This regional growth presents a primary expansion opportunity for manufacturers.
There is a growing trend of integrating digital technologies like IIoT (Industrial Internet of Things) and AI-driven predictive analytics with low-speed motors and generators. This enables real-time monitoring, predictive maintenance, and operational optimization, reducing downtime and enhancing the safety of oil and gas operations.
The global market for low-speed motors and generators is an integral component of the oil and gas equipment industry, providing the essential motive force for critical high-torque applications. These systems are fundamental to upstream, midstream, and downstream operations, powering equipment like mud pumps, drawworks, top drives, and various compressors. The market's dynamics are intrinsically linked to global energy demand, exploration and production (E&P) capital expenditure, and the ongoing need to upgrade and maintain aging infrastructure for improved efficiency and compliance with stringent environmental and safety standards.
Sustained Global Energy Demand: Despite the push for renewables, fossil fuels remain a cornerstone of the global energy mix. The continuous need for oil and gas drives exploration and production activities, directly fueling the demand for reliable and powerful low-speed motors and generators to operate heavy-duty machinery.
Modernization and Upgrading of Aging Infrastructure: Much of the existing equipment in the oil and gas sector is aging. There is a strong driver to replace or upgrade these systems with more modern, energy-efficient, and reliable low-speed motors and generators to reduce operational costs, minimize downtime, and comply with stricter safety regulations.
Expansion of Unconventional and Deepwater Exploration: The exploration and extraction of oil and gas from unconventional sources like shale and deepwater reserves require highly specialized and powerful equipment. This trend boosts demand for robust low-speed motors and generators capable of operating under harsh and demanding conditions.
Adoption of Permanent Magnet (PM) Motor Technology: There is a clear trend towards adopting PM motors over traditional induction motors. PM motors offer higher efficiency, greater power density, and a more compact design, which is highly advantageous for space-constrained applications like offshore platforms and mobile drilling rigs.
Integration of Industrial Internet of Things (IIoT): Manufacturers are increasingly embedding sensors and connectivity features into motors and generators. This IIoT integration allows for real-time performance monitoring, data analytics, and predictive maintenance, leading to enhanced operational efficiency and a significant reduction in unexpected equipment failures.
Focus on Direct-Drive Systems: The development of high-torque, low-speed direct-drive motors is a significant trend. By eliminating the need for mechanical gearboxes, these systems reduce mechanical complexity, improve overall system efficiency, decrease maintenance requirements, and lower the physical footprint of the machinery.
Volatility in Crude Oil Prices: The oil and gas industry is highly sensitive to fluctuations in crude oil prices. Periods of low prices lead to reduced capital expenditure and delayed projects, which directly curtails investment in new equipment, including low-speed motors and generators.
High Initial Investment and Maintenance Costs: High-performance, low-speed motors and generators, especially those designed for hazardous environments, come with a significant upfront cost. The specialized maintenance required to ensure their longevity and safety also adds to the total cost of ownership, which can be a barrier for some operators.
Global Shift Towards Renewable Energy: The increasing global emphasis on decarbonization and the long-term transition towards renewable energy sources pose a systemic threat to the oil and gas industry. This shift could lead to a gradual decline in new large-scale fossil fuel projects, thereby restraining the long-term growth of the associated equipment market.

The global market for low-speed motors and generators in the oil and gas industry exhibits distinct regional dynamics, influenced by local energy policies, investment climates, and technological adoption rates. Asia Pacific leads the market in both size and growth, while North America remains a significant player due to its extensive shale and conventional oil and gas activities. Emerging economies in South America and Africa are also poised for notable growth as they develop their energy resources.

Technology Focus
The technology focus in North America is on developing extremely durable motors and generators that can withstand the demanding cycles of hydraulic fracturing. There is also a strong emphasis on Class I, Division 1/2 certified explosion-proof designs and the integration of advanced variable frequency drives (VFDs) for precise speed and torque control, which is critical for optimizing production and ensuring safety.

Technology Focus
The European technology focus is on high-integrity systems for subsea and offshore applications. This includes developing pressure-compensated, sealed motors for deepwater operation, advanced cooling systems, and materials resistant to corrosion from saltwater. There is also a strong emphasis on ATEX-certified equipment for explosive atmospheres and integrated condition monitoring systems.

Technology Focus
The primary technology focus in South America is on solutions for deepwater and ultra-deepwater environments. This includes highly reliable, maintenance-free subsea motors, high-pressure pump motors for FPSOs, and robust systems capable of handling corrosive fluids and immense pressures associated with pre-salt reservoirs.

Technology Focus
The technology focus in the Middle East is on ultra-reliable, high-power motors and generators designed for continuous operation in extreme ambient temperatures. There is a significant demand for custom-engineered solutions for large-scale pump and compressor applications in both onshore and offshore settings. Equipment must adhere to stringent standards set by major operators like Saudi Aramco and ADNOC.
